International Perspectives on the Assessment and Treatment of Sexual Offenders
Theory, Practice and Research
Douglas P. Boer , Dr Reinhard Eher , Friedemann Pfäfflin , Leam A. Craig , Michael H. Miner
- Presents a comprehensive overview of current theories and practices relating to the assessment and treatment of sex offenders throughout the world, including the US, Europe, and Australasia
- Covers all the major developments in the areas of risk assessment, treatment, and management
- Includes chapters written by internationally respected practitioners and researchers experienced in working with sexual offenders such as Bill Marshall, Ruth Mann, Karl Hanson and Jayson Ware
